Students are allowed to use their own calculators on the PSAT - scientific or graphing calculators are recommended. Students are not allowed to use the following, however:1. pocket organizers2. laptops and handheld devices3. cell phone calculators4. calculators with a QWERTY keypad5. calculators that require an electrical outlet
Also, students can't share calculators. Math questions on the PSAT can be solved WITHOUT a calculator but students are allowed to use one if they bring their own. We will not be providing students with calculators for the PSAT.

Addition and Subtraction of
Matrices
To add matrices, we add the corresponding elements. They must have the same dimensions.

When a zero matrix is added to another matrix of the same dimension, that same matrix is obtained.
To subtract matrices, we subtract the corresponding elements. The matrices must have the same dimensions.
